uvm_exhaustive_sequence Class Reference

Inheritance diagram for class uvm_exhaustive_sequence:

List of all members.



Public Member Functions

task   body ( )
function uvm_object  create ( string name = "" )
function bit  do_compare ( uvm_object rhs, uvm_comparer comparer )
function void  do_copy ( uvm_object rhs )
function void  do_print ( uvm_printer printer )
function void  do_record ( uvm_recorder recorder )
virtual function uvm_object_wrapper  get_object_type ( )
static function type_id  get_type ( )
virtual function string  get_type_name ( )
function void  new ( string name = "uvm_exhaustive_sequence" )

Public Attributes


Protected Attributes

rand protected int unsigned  l_count 
protected bit  m_success 

Member Typedefs

 typedef class  type_id 


Member Function Documentation

  task
 uvm_exhaustive_sequence::body

 (   ) 


 Superseded tasks 
 uvm_sequence_base :: body 

  function uvm_object
 uvm_exhaustive_sequence::create

 (  string name = ""  ) 


 Superseded functions 
 uvm_object :: create 

  function bit
 uvm_exhaustive_sequence::do_compare

 (  uvm_object rhs , uvm_comparer comparer  ) 


 Superseded functions 
 uvm_object :: do_compare 

  function void
 uvm_exhaustive_sequence::do_copy

 (  uvm_object rhs  ) 


 Superseded functions 
 uvm_object :: do_copy 
 uvm_transaction :: do_copy 

  function void
 uvm_exhaustive_sequence::do_print

 (  uvm_printer printer  ) 


 Superseded functions 
 uvm_object :: do_print 
 uvm_transaction :: do_print 
 uvm_sequence_item :: do_print 
 uvm_sequence :: do_print 

  function void
 uvm_exhaustive_sequence::do_record

 (  uvm_recorder recorder  ) 


 Superseded functions 
 uvm_object :: do_record 
 uvm_transaction :: do_record 

 virtual function uvm_object_wrapper
 uvm_exhaustive_sequence::get_object_type

 (   ) 


 Superseded functions 
 uvm_object :: get_object_type 
 uvm_sequence_item :: get_object_type 

 static function type_id
 uvm_exhaustive_sequence::get_type

 (   ) 


 Superseded functions 
 uvm_object :: get_type 
 uvm_sequence_item :: get_type 

 virtual function string
 uvm_exhaustive_sequence::get_type_name

 (   ) 


 Superseded functions 
 uvm_object :: get_type_name 
 uvm_sequence_item :: get_type_name 

  function void
 uvm_exhaustive_sequence::new

 (  string name = "uvm_exhaustive_sequence"  ) 


 Superseded functions 
 uvm_object :: new 
 uvm_sequence_item :: new 
 uvm_sequence_base :: new 
 uvm_sequence :: new 


Member Attribute Documentation

 rand protected int unsigned  attribute
 uvm_exhaustive_sequence::l_count

 protected bit  attribute
 uvm_exhaustive_sequence::m_success


Member Typedef Documentation

 typedef class  uvm_exhaustive_sequence::type_id
 Typedefe'd string ==>   uvm_object_registry#(uvm_exhaustive_sequence,)